# Tilecrumb Prefetcher — Environment Variables

The Tilecrumb prefetcher warms the map-tile cache ahead of regional traffic spikes. It reads its configuration entirely from the environment at startup; there is no config file fallback. Release builds must set the region list, the concurrency cap, and the upstream tile host before the service will boot. The prefetcher also authenticates to the tile origin on every batch, so the release environment file must include the following line:

sealed setting: COURIER_KEY8=0dbae41b

Alert: consent-banner-rollout-stalled

The Hearthvane consent banner rollout has been stuck below 40% of tenants for over six hours, which usually means a plugin is blocking the banner's init hook. If your plugin touches page load, double-check you're not swallowing the hook's promise. Stuck on how to make yours compatible? Ping the rollout crew below.

billing contact of yawip-yadup = druath.casdor@nelvrolabs.internal

Welcome to the Parcellia platform team. Your first assignment touches the extraction of the user module from the Hivecore monolith into its own service. Follow the strangler pattern already sketched in the architecture notes: route reads first, then writes. Deploys to the staging cluster go through the split-service pipeline, which requires you to register a deploy key. Use this one:

rollout seal: bky4_yke3

Ticket: Config drift on the Haldane garage occupancy feed. The Ostermill node is publishing counts every 5s while the other three garages publish every 15s, which skews the aggregation window downstream in Lotgrid. Someone hot-patched the interval during the holiday surge and never reverted. Please review the diff and restore parity across all nodes. The intended baseline configuration is as follows.

settings of kahip-hafop:
ralix:
  log_level: warn
  metrics_host: metrics.ralix.zemvarsys.internal
  pin: 8273
  pool_size: 8